Being a slender brush with long, delicate bristles, it provides you with a steadier hand compared to shorter bristle brushes. This enables you to skillfully outline the profile of an infilled fragment, paint its surface, and delicately trace even the thinnest cracks, resulting in perfectly slender and uniform lines.
Brushes hold a special significance as cherished tools in the practices of Kintsugi and Maki-e. While various types of brushes are valuable, each contributes to enhancing specific techniques within your artistic journey.
Specifications:
Material: Feline hair sourced ethically
